Instructions for Cooking the Chicken Chipotle Recipe Right
Step 1: Whip Up Fiery Sauce
Toss all ingredients into a blender and pulse until silky smooth. Set the vibrant sauce aside.
Step 2: Massage Chicken with Flavor
Lovingly rub the chicken with the aromatic spice blend, ensuring every inch is coated with zesty goodness.
Step 3: Sizzle the Protein
Stovetop Method:
Warm a large skillet over medium heat. Lay the seasoned chicken down and cook until golden brown and cooked through, about 5-6 minutes per side.
Grill Method:
Fire up the grill to medium-high heat. Place chicken on the grates and cook 6-8 minutes per side, creating beautiful char marks.
Step 4: Bathe Chicken in Spicy Goodness
Drizzle the prepared chipotle sauce over the cooked chicken. Let it simmer and bubble, allowing the sauce to slightly thicken and hug the meat.
Step 5: Plate and Celebrate
Slice or shred the chicken. Sprinkle fresh cilantro on top and serve with bright lime wedges for an extra zing.

Ingredients
Protein:
- 1 ½ lbs (680g) bo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s
Spices and Seasonings:
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- 1 teaspoon chili pow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- 2 chipotle peppers in adobo sauce (canned)
- 1 tablespoon adobo sauce (from the can)
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
Additional Ingredients:
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Juice of 1 lime
- ¼ cup chicken broth (optional, for thinner sauce)
- Fresh cilantro, chopped (for garnish)
Instructions
- Craft a vibrant chipotle sauce by blending smoky chipotle peppers, tangy adobo sauce, aromatic garlic, zesty lime juice, and rich chicken broth until achieving a silky smooth consistency.
- Massage the chicken with a robust spice blend of olive oil, smoked paprika, earthy cumin, fiery chili powder, and seasoned salt and pepper, ensuring complete and even coating.
- Select your preferred cooking method: for stovetop, activate a large skillet over medium heat and sear the chicken until golden and thoroughly cooked, approximately 5-6 minutes per side.
- Alternatively, for grilling enthusiasts, heat the grill to medium-high and cook the chicken, creating beautiful char marks and sealing in succulent flavors for 6-8 minutes per side.
- Once chicken reaches optimal doneness, generously drench the meat with prepared chipotle sauce, allowing it to gently simmer and reduce for 2-3 minutes, creating a luscious glaze.
- Finish the dish by either delicately slicing or pulling the chicken into tender strands, adorning with fresh cilantro and presenting with bright lime wedges for an additional flavor burst.
Notes
- Master the sauce’s consistency by adjusting liquid ratios, ensuring a smooth, rich texture that coats the chicken perfectly.
- Choose bone-in or boneless chicken based on preference, but remember bone-in options often deliver deeper flavor and juicier meat.
- Control spice levels by reducing chipotle peppers or selecting mild adobo sauce for sensitive palates without compromising the recipe’s core taste profile.
- Create versatile meal options by transforming this chicken into tacos, burrito bowls, salads, or meal prep containers for quick, delicious lunches.
